Compartilhar via


Criando aplicativos com o SQL Server Native Client

Aplica-se a: SQL Server Banco de Dados SQL do Azure Instância Gerenciada de SQL do Azure Azure Synapse Analytics Analytics Platform System (PDW)

Importante

O SQL Server Native Client (SNAC) não é fornecido com:

  • SQL Server 2022 (16.x) e versões posteriores
  • SQL Server Management Studio 19 e versões posteriores

O SQL Server Native Client (SQLNCLI ou SQLNCLI11) e o provedor OLE DB para SQL Server (SQLOLEDB) da Microsoft herdado não são recomendados para desenvolver um novo aplicativo.

Para novos projetos, use um dos seguintes drivers:

Para SQLNCLI que é fornecido como um componente do Mecanismo de Banco de Dados do SQL Server (versões 2012 a 2019), confira esta exceção de Ciclo de Vida de Suporte.

Ao desenvolver um aplicativo que usa a biblioteca SQL Server Native Client, há vários problemas que entram em jogo. Os tópicos desta seção discutem muitos desses problemas, incluindo a atualização do MDAC para o SQL Server Native Client, o uso do cabeçalho e dos arquivos de biblioteca do SQL Server Native Client e uma visão geral das várias cadeias de conexão que podem ser usadas com o SQL Server Native Client.

Nesta seção

Instalando o SQL Server Native Client
Discute como o SQL Server Native Client é instalado, os locais em que os vários componentes são instalados e como desinstalar o SQL Server Native Client.

Componentes do SQL Server Native Client
Discute os componentes que compõem o SQL Server Native Client, incluindo arquivos de biblioteca, recurso, ajuda e cabeçalho.

Usando palavras-chave da cadeia de conexão com o SQL Server Native Client
Discute os vários tipos de cadeias de conexão que podem ser usadas ao se conectar a um banco de dados por meio do SQL Server Native Client.

Usando os arquivos de biblioteca e de cabeçalho do SQL Server Native Client
Discute como usar o cabeçalho do SQL Server Native Client e os arquivos de biblioteca em um aplicativo.

Atualizando um aplicativo do MDAC para o SQL Server Native Client
Discute as diferenças entre o SQL Server Native Client e o MDAC e os problemas que devem ser considerados ao atualizar do MDAC para o SQL Server Native Client.

Atualizando um aplicativo no SQL Server 2005 Native Client
Discute problemas que devem ser considerados ao atualizar do SQL Server 2005 (9.x) Native Client para o SQL Server Native Client no SQL Server 2012 (11.x).

Usando o ADO com SQL Server Native Client
Discute como o ADO pode usar o SQL Server Native Client para acessar e usar a funcionalidade do SQL Server.

Políticas de suporte do SQL Server Native Client
Discute como vários componentes de acesso a dados podem ser usados com diferentes versões do SQL Server Native Client.

Conectando-se a um Banco de Dados SQL do Azure usando o SQL Server Native Client
Discute como se conectar a um Banco de Dados SQL usando o SQL Server Native Client.

Confira também

Programação do SQL Server Native Client
Tópicos de instruções sobre ODBC
Tópicos de instruções do OLE DB